Synaptic Digital Taps Kevin McCarthy to Head Washington DC Office


New York, March 1, 2012 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Synaptic Digital, the world’s premier multichannel video creation and distribution company, today named Kevin McCarthy to the position of Director, Client Solutions, effective immediately.  Mr. McCarthy, an international news and video production expert, will be responsible for growing the business in the Washington D.C. area and will be based out of Synaptic Digital’s office at the National Press Club.

Over the past decade, Mr. McCarthy has been the owner of McCarthy Production Group, which provides broadcast television production consulting to a wide range of clients including news outlets, corporations, and government agencies. Projects include live production management for the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) and the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A), as well as consulting on the expansion of a television facility in Kabul, Afghanistan for the United States Agency for International Development (USAID).

"Kevin has nearly 20 years of experience in television production including 15 years in the PR services space.  He understands the needs of journalists, newsroom producers, and international productions," said Scott Michaeloff, Senior Vice President, Executive Producer, Synaptic Digital. "I believe our client base in Washington D.C. will benefit greatly from Kevin’s counsel, perspective, and innovative production techniques."

Previously, Kevin worked for Synaptic Digital’s predecessor, Medialink, where he was a Senior Producer in the Live Events department providing production planning and on-site management for all aspects of live television production. Before joining Medialink, Kevin was at ABC’s News Agency WTN (now part of APTN) where as a Project Manager he was responsible for overseeing large-scale remote productions for numerous international and domestic news broadcasters. Kevin began his career working for NewSport, the first ever 24/7 sports news network created by Cablevision, where he managed the satellite coordination department. 

He says, "I’ve spent the last decade working in the DC area for a wide range of Government, commercial and broadcast clients across the PR services arena. I look forward to harnessing the many resources Synaptic Digital has to offer to best serve the Washington D.C. communications community."
